No support. I use git and I don't think it would be a good fit for scratch. Scratch has emphasized many times that they want to keep the coding interface simple and introducing things like commits, branches, and repositories would make a lot of young scratchers confused.

Suppose some person A makes a project for insulting a person B (for example, the project has “B is stupid and they suck”). Then, as soon as it gets popular and someone reports it, person A changes the project to remove traces of the insults. In this case, the ST wouldn't have any evidence that person A did anything bad.
Now suppose Scratch had version control. Then, the version of the project with the insults would still be stored on Scratch's servers, since version control keeps track of all versions. Here, the ST would still have the old version, so they'd have the evidence for an alert.
Now please explain why version control would make moderation more difficult. I don't see how it would.
